Our non-real estate loans included in the Triple-Net segment consist of fixed and variable rate loans to operators or principals. These loans may be either unsecured or secured by the collateral of the borrower, which may include the working capital of the borrower and/or personal guarantees. As of June 30, 2026, we had 35 loans with 23 different borrowers. A summary of our non-real estate loans by loan type is as follows:

- What does triple net investments — number of borrowers mean?
- This measures the total count of unique entities or operators that have received financing through the triple net investment segment. It is a key indicator of portfolio concentration risk; a lower number suggests higher dependency on a few key operators. Investors monitor this to evaluate the company's exposure to individual counterparty risk.
